Zlatý Ležák

Czech Pilsner

Brewed TBA

A golden Czech lager made from the yeast cake from Vltava Pils. A golden Bohlemian lager that is simple but delicious.

Ingredients

Malts

11 lbs 2 Row Pilsner Malt

0.5 lb Cara-Pils/Dextrine

Hops

4 oz Tettnang hops (4.2% AA)

Yeast

Yeast Cake from Vltava Pils (Imperial Urkel Yeast)

Brewing Instructions

1. Add 6 gallons of water to the kettle and brewing salts

2. Heat 6 gallons of strike water to 158°F

3. Add 6 gallons of water to the mash tun

4. Add all grains to the mash tun and confirm mash temperature of 152°F

5. Steep grains for 60 minutes

6. While steeping grains, heat 4 gallons of water for lautering to 170 °F

7. Fly spage until wort volume of 7.4 gallons is reached

8. Begin boil and wait for hot break

9. At 0 minutes, add 7 drops of FermCap to reduce foaming

10. At 0 minutes, add 2.0 oz Tettnang hops

11. At 50 minutes, add 2.0 oz Tettnang hops

12. At 50 minutes, add 1 tablet Whirlfloc

13. At 50 minutes, add 0.5 tsp of yeast nutrient

14. At 60 minutes, chil the wort to 68°F

15. Shake fermenter to aerate wort

16. Move wort to primary fermenter

17. Pitch yeast

18. Ferment at 54°F for 7 days (or until a couple points above FG

19. Ferment at 65°F for 4 days

20. Ferment at 52°F for 4 days

21. Lower temp by -4°F daily to reach 34°F over 7 days

22. Condition at 34°F for 14 days

23. Move to keg and carbonate

Starter & Notes

None - reuse yeast cake from Vltava Pils
